Bulma hopped right to her task of hooking up the EEG's (A/N: electroencepalograms, they monitor brain waves and other cerebral activity) to the two subject's heads, turned a few switches here, a few levers there, and placed a microchip in each one of the subject's ears. A light humming sound could be heard as the two subjects reached optimum brain-wave patterns; a red vinyl sheet, looking eerily like an unzipped body bag, was placed over both subjects.

Bulma whispered to Kuririn, "If you need to get out because of endangerment to your life, please notify me."

"How?"

"Ask, and your brain waves will change. This EEG is very sensitive."

"Oh." Kuririn breathed heavily under the red sheet, and tried to get his composure before the procedure.

His brain waves having been restored to optimum by his relaxation, Bulma continued.

The mattresses of the two beds were brought to near-ceiling level, to better access the computerized resonance imaging system. A pair of wide laser beams came down over both Kuririn's and #18's heads, scanning their brains, down to the last synapse. Bulma worked with the computerized images and fed them back to the microchips in their ear canals.

Kuririn was still nervous, but if it was for Juuhachigoo's good, he couldn't argue…

--

Kuririn found himself in what looked like the inside of a giant windowless warehouse, all concrete; no detail anywhere. All the same monotonous shade of gray.

If this is Juu-chan's mind, he thought, it must be some kind of blank slate. Either that or Gero took it…

A loud female scream interrupted his thoughts; young, he guessed around six or seven, and blood-curdling.

Around the corner he saw a half-materialized little girl with bright, warm blue eyes, long blond pigtails, a green dress with a white Peter Pan collar, and what appeared to be white socks and black shoes. Her face wore an expression of absolute fear, and her little sometimes-there-sometimes-not legs were running as if she were being chased by a horde of demons after her soul.

She stopped a moment to catch her breath, and saw Kuririn standing not ten feet from her.

Again she started to run, this time towards Kuririn, her eyes wide in desperation.

"Mister," she panted, "can you help me?" A tear dripped from her left eye.

"What's the matter?" Kuririn patted the little girl's head.

She leaned into Kuririn's T-shirt and started to cry. "They-they're chasing me, mister, and they want to kill me…and I don't know where my brother is and I'm lost and alone and scared…help me!"

"I'll help." Kuririn was quite moved by the little girl's plea. "What's your name?"

"M-Miki," she stuttered, her voice not yet overcoming her crying spell.

"Who's chasing you?"

"They are."

"Who are 'they'?"

"You'll know them when you see them." Miki looked Kuririn in the eye. "Trust me, mister…Maybe I can take you to my drawing corner, that's where I go get my anger out." With that, Miki ran to a small enclave in the "building".

Kuririn was astonished by what he saw…

Crude, childlike drawings of Dr. Gero. Cyborg plans taped to the floor. A dark figure he didn't recognize…

"Whaddya think?" Miki grinned.

"I-Impressive!" Kuririn put his hand behind and giggled.

"Shh, you're too loud. They might hear you and try to kill you too."

"I understand. Now where do we go from here?"

"Dunno, I usually trust my gut." The six-year-old image of Juuhachigoo's human psyche pulled Kuririn towards a destination in the "warehouse" he knew not of….
